My younger daughter and I decorated our Christmas tree in the dining room. This is where we gather together with family and friends for the holidays. We placed the tree by a French door that’s beside our family room and opposite to our front door, and so I feel like this is a perfect location.
Over the years, we’ve often decorated real Christmas trees, which we love. Additionally, I happened to purchase this tree at IKEA a few years ago. It’s affordable and perfect for our small home as well.
Upon fluffing and arranging the branches, I added classic white lights and an angel tree topper. At nighttime, it feels so warm and magical with the sparkling lights.

Our Christmas tree is decorated with ornaments that we’ve collected, like traditional European glass ornaments. One year, I bought painted wooden ornaments while attending a classic Victorian Christmas event. We have ornaments that were gifts and other cherished ornaments that were handmade by my daughters.
Ribbon is a pretty, inexpensive, and festive decoration for the holidays. This year, we placed bows that I made from red satin ribbon on the tree. I love decorating for the holidays with velvet ribbon as well. In addition, I found the soft blue ribbon while shopping at a craft store.
